虚拟机Win7网络连接故障解决方案
虚拟机中安装的win7无法连接网络

首页 2025-01-24 23:26:04



虚拟机中Win7无法连接网络的深度解析与解决方案 在信息化高速发展的今天,虚拟机技术已成为我们日常开发、测试、学习不可或缺的重要工具

    它不仅能够让我们在同一台物理机上运行多个操作系统,还能有效地隔离资源,提高系统的安全性和灵活性

    然而,在实际使用过程中,虚拟机中安装的Windows 7(简称Win7)无法连接网络的问题,时常困扰着许多用户,这不仅影响了工作效率,还可能阻碍学习进度

    本文将从多个维度深入剖析这一问题的成因,并提供一系列切实可行的解决方案,帮助用户迅速恢复虚拟机的网络连接

     一、问题概述 虚拟机中Win7无法连接网络的现象多种多样,包括但不限于:无法识别网络适配器、IP地址获取失败、无法访问局域网资源、无法访问互联网等

    这些问题的出现,往往伴随着错误提示,如“网络电缆被拔出”、“本地连接没有有效的IP配置”等,让用户感到困惑和无助

     二、问题成因分析 1.虚拟机网络配置不当 -桥接模式(Bridged):如果虚拟机设置为桥接模式,它应直接连接到宿主机的网络,与宿主机处于同一子网

    若配置错误或宿主机网络适配器存在问题,虚拟机将无法获取IP地址或无法与外部网络通信

     -NAT模式(Network Address Translation):NAT模式下,虚拟机通过宿主机访问外部网络,宿主机作为网关

    如果NAT服务未正确运行或配置有误,虚拟机将无法访问互联网

     -仅主机模式(Host-Only):此模式下,虚拟机仅能与宿主机通信,无法访问外部网络

    如果错误地将虚拟机设置为仅主机模式,而用户又需要访问外部网络,自然会遇到连接问题

     2.Win7系统网络设置问题 -网络适配器驱动:虚拟机中的Win7系统可能因缺少合适的网络适配器驱动而无法正常工作

     -TCP/IP协议栈:TCP/IP协议栈配置错误或损坏,也会导致网络连接问题

     -防火墙和安全软件:Win7内置的防火墙或安装的第三方安全软件可能阻止网络访问

     3.虚拟机软件问题 -版本兼容性:某些虚拟机软件的新版本可能不完全兼容Win7,导致网络功能异常

     -软件Bug:虚拟机软件本身可能存在未修复的Bug,影响网络功能

     4.宿主机环境问题 -网络硬件故障:宿主机的网络硬件(如网卡)故障,直接影响虚拟机网络连接

     -网络配置冲突:宿主机上的网络配置(如IP地址、子网掩码等)与虚拟机设置冲突,导致网络不通

     三、解决方案 针对上述分析,以下是一系列针对性的解决方案,旨在帮助用户快速解决虚拟机中Win7无法连接网络的问题

     1.检查并调整虚拟机网络配置 - 确认虚拟机网络模式:根据需求选择合适的网络模式(桥接、NAT、仅主机)

     - 检查网络适配器设置:确保虚拟机中网络适配器已启用,且配置正确(如桥接到正确的物理网卡)

     - 重启虚拟机网络服务:在虚拟机内重启网络服务或重新配置网络适配器,以刷新网络设置

     2.更新和修复Win7网络设置 - 安装或更新网络适配器驱动:通过虚拟机软件的“设备”菜单,检查并更新网络适配器驱动

     - 重置TCP/IP协议栈:在Win7命令提示符下执行`netsh winsock reset`和`netsh int ipreset`命令,重置TCP/IP协议栈

     - 禁用或调整防火墙设置:暂时禁用防火墙,检查是否影响网络连接;若不影响,则逐步开放必要端口或调整防火墙规则

     3.升级或修复虚拟机软件 - 检查虚拟机软件更新:访问虚拟机软件官网,下载并安装最新版本,以解决已知的兼容性和Bug问题

     - 重新安装虚拟机工具:虚拟机工具(如VMware Tools、VirtualBox Guest Additions)对于优化虚拟机和宿主机之间的通信至关重要

    重新安装这些工具可能解决网络连接问题

     4.排查和修复宿主机环境问题 - 检查宿主机网络硬件:确保宿主机网卡工作正常,无物理损坏或连接松动

     - 排查网络配置冲突:检查宿主机和虚拟机的IP地址、子网掩码、网关等配置,确保无冲突

     - 重启宿主机网络服务:在宿主机上重启网络服务,以清除可能的网络配置缓存或错误

     5.高级故障排除 - 使用网络诊断工具:利用虚拟机内外的网络诊断工具(如ping、traceroute、nslookup等),定位网络故障点

     - 查看日志文件:检查虚拟机、宿主机以及网络设备(如路由器、交换机)的日志文件,寻找可能的错误信息或警告

     - 联系技术支持:若上述方法均未能解决问题,考虑联系虚拟机软件或网络设备的技术支持团队,获取专业帮助

     四、结语 虚拟机中Win7无法连接网络的问题,虽看似复杂,但通过系统而细致的检查与调整,大多能够得到有效解决

    关键在于理解问题的根源,采取正确的解决策略,并耐心执行每一步操作

    希望本文提供的解决方案能帮助广大用户摆脱虚拟机网络连接的困扰,提升工作效率和学习体验

    同时,也提醒用户在日常使用中,注意备份重要数据,定期更新软件,以预防类似问题的发生

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道